    They key is to "target" the QuickTime Player instead of the browser plug-in.
    This is done with new "tags" in the special html code and a secondary .mov file that acts as a "poster movie". When the visitor clicks on the poster movie the 'href' (linked file) URL loads in the QuickTime Player. The poster movie could be a small image file (saved as .mov) to act as a button.
    QuickTime Player Pro can add special "Presentation" properties to a file such as "Full Screen" and "Quit when done".
    Snow Leopard's QuickTime X doesn't seem to like the stored Presentation feature, however. One of my pages that shows how it works (sort of). View Source to see the html code.

    Try trash the com.apple.iPhoto.plist file from the HD/Users/ Your Name / library / preferences folder. (Remember you'll need to reset your User options afterwards. These include minor settings like the window colour and so on. Note: If you've moved your library you'll need to point iPhoto at it again.)
    What's the plist file?
    For new users: Every application on your Mac has an accompanying plist file. It records certain User choices. For instance, in your favourite Word Processor it remembers your choice of Default Font, on your Web Browser is remembers things like your choice of Home Page. It even recalls what windows you had open last if your app allows you to pick up from where you left off last. The iPhoto plist file remembers things like the location of the Library, your choice of background colour, whether you are running a Referenced or Managed Library, what preferences you have for autosplitting events and so on. Trashing the plist file forces the app to generate a new one on the next launch, and this restores things to the Factory Defaults. Hence, if you've changed any of these things you'll need to reset them. If you haven't, then no bother. Trashing the plist file is Mac troubleshooting 101.

    It's pretty simple to create your own Full Screen keyboard shortcut. Here is what I did and it works perfectly:
    1. System Preferences
    2. Keyboard
    3. Keyboard Shortcuts tab
    4. Application Shortcuts
    5. Click + symbol at bottom or right box and select All Applications
    6. Set Menu Title for Enter Full Screen &  Set Keyboard Shortcut for Control + Command + F click Add
    7. Repeat Step 5
    8. Set Menu Title for Exit Full Screen &  Set Keyboard Shortcut for Control + Command + F click Add
    9. Exit System Preferences and use the new keyboard shortcuts on all apps that have Full Screen capabilities.

    Try quitting Safari like I describe, then reset the iPad. Double click the Home button to show the screen with running and recently used apps. Each app icon will have a sample page above it. Flick up on the page (not the app icon) and the page will fly away and the app icon will disappear. This quits that app. Then Press and hold both the Home button and the Sleep/Wake button continuously until the Apple logo appears. Then release the button and let the device restart. You will not lose data doing this. It's like a computer reboot.
    I would also suggest that you check to make sure that you have enough free space on your iPad for it to run efficiently. With iOS 8 it is recommended that you have 15-20% of the storage space on the device free.  For a 16 GB device that is 2.4-3.2 GB free. For a 32 GB device that is 4.8-6.4 GB free. For a 64 GB device that is 9.6-12.8 GB free.
